Garbage prepares to “bleed”

Rock act Garbage will release its first album in more than three years, “Bleed Like Me,” April 12 in North America via Geffen and a day earlier internationally via Warner Bros. Fans to appear on new Garbage video

Garbage have asked their American fans to star in the video for their next single, “Why Do You Love Me”. The Stupid Girl rockers, fronted by Shirley Manson, are recording the promotional clip in Los Angeles later this month (January 31st). Shirley performs “Call Me” with Blondie

Shirley Manson performs with Blondie on stage at the 5th Annual “Women Rock!,” Lifetime Television’s fifth annual signature concert for the fight against breast cancer, held at the Wiltern on September 28, 2004 in Los Angeles, California. They perform Blondie’s “Call Me”
